  • 1.0 stars

    "I feel hoodwinked with the false claims"

    January 11, 2012  |   By vavastrat

    Version: Drive Genius 3.1.2

    Pros

    Vertigo inducing GUI for those who are so inclined

    Cons

    Doesn't do the simplest of Disk repair functions.

    Summary

    I couldn't get my backup drive to mount on my Intel mac book and so, after reading the remarkable abilities advertised on the OWC site, I ordered Drive Genius 3.0 .
    After getting somewhat used to the vertigo producing GUI, I set out to repair my HFS+ drive. To my dread, It wouldn't repair nor defrag my drive. It just simply said it couldn't. No further tips or suggestions. Just that it couldn't.
    Well I thought "Oh Boy $1000 bucks for a data recovery company." I then tried one more thing as a lark. I powered up Diskwarrior and lo and behold; a replaced directory and all my data was back, less the name of my drive.
    Not to be able to do a disk defrag by a program that Prosoft touts it to be what they claim? I felt hoodwinked and so I tried returning the software.
    OWC was very understanding and suggested I call Prosoft and get an authorization to return the software.
    When I called, I was told by Bob at Prosoft that "no software company guarantees their software so there would be no returns authorized by him".
    Well, I strongly suggest you save your money and stick with Diskwarrior and Apple's disk utility for your Disk maintenance needs.
